A shame the 93-94 had the leftover Camaro mirrors bolted on the doors taking away from the beautiful body lines, OBDI and no LT-1. 96 in this condition is one of my wants since I sold my 95. Has the mirrors on the corner post, not taking away from the gorgeous body lines, LT-1 with plenty of power and OBDII along with some other upgrades. I worked at a Cadillac dealership from 1991 to the 1993 with detailed these cars new awesome car it was a bit of a boat I like the front wheel drive sevilles and devilles with the 4.9 or 32 valve v8s. This car was probably more reliable than those and you should never buy any of the Cadillacs with the 4.1 l because they were trash. The dealership I work for stocked brand new 4.1 l they came in all the time for replacement so never buy one with the 4.1 . These cars here though were pretty solid came with a 350 V8 pretty much bulletproof as most 350s were.
